Personality- affectionate, playful, energetic, social, loves to be with people and is a bit of a velcro dog. He does bark to alert if someone arrives etc. but is not an overly yappy fellow.
Strangers- Sometimes nervous and barks at men but overall very social
Dogs- great with all dogs.
Cats- not exposed to cats here
Little kids- Great with kids of all ages..does jump up, however
Energy level-medium
House rules - Sleeps in crate thru day if no one is home but not at night.. and now has become a great bed buddy to sleep with . He loves to get on sofa and cuddle while watching tv.
Needs to be accompanied when out to potty to make sure he does it. He does not like to go out if it is raining and when he first arrived he would mark in the house and go on mats inside if not supervised. He is now trained and has not had any accidents inside.
Update from foster mom - Danny is sleeping through the night now and have not had any recent accidents inside

The longest I have left him has been 4 hours and the bed was shredded and his blanket wet d/t to drooling { stress }. He will shred any bedding in his crate when he is alone and he also does vocalize so would not advise an apartment /townhouse that might bother neighbours and is not suitable for him.
Danny definitely is a dog that likes company, he is a bit of a Velcro dog. I think he could manage as an only dog as long he had human company and was not left alone for extended periods of time. A retiree might be better. He seems fine if left with only a mat and no shreddable bedding for a couple of hours and with other dogs nearby, but he does not like it. I think maybe the extended time crated on that air flight may have affected these guys anxiety with being crated and left.
He is fine in the crate at night but he is in a room with other dogs and me

Food- He loves food..all food.
Crate- trained. Good in crate. May protest a few minutes at first but then settles down
Toys- Likes to chase balls but won’t bring them back. Not a real toy obsessed guy
Likes-people, cuddles, attention, walks.
Dislikes- can be a bit nervous with loud noises such as noisy trucks and farm equipment sounds
Leash- Walks well on leash
Grooming- Fine with grooming, enjoys it
Traveling- Travels well. Prefers not to be crated in the car but is ok in crate though can be a bit vocal
Fears- loud noises, sudden unexpected movement on walks make him a bit skittish
Best home- Pretty adaptable. Should be great in any home that can give him the attention he enjoys. He does get underfoot and will lie down right at your feet when working in the kitchen so have to be aware and if someone is unsteady or with children that could fall on him or bother it may be of concern as he is small. He would do best with a fenced yard as he will go exploring when outside and seems drawn to water(pond)
Routine-Out first thing in the morning to potty. If not accompanied may not go. Then breakfast, then throughout the day play with other dogs in fenced yard, outside when needed, walks, etc. Sleeps at night in crate in bedroom and is crated if we go out.
